seop的操作步骤英文回答:SEO (Search Engine Optimization) is the process of optimizing a website or webpage to improve its visibility and ranking on search engine results pages (SERPs). It involves various techniques and strategies to make the website more search engine-friendly and attract organic (non-paid) traffic.Here are the steps involved in performing SEO:1. Keyword Research: This is the first and most crucial step in SEO. It involves identifying the relevant keywords and phrases that users are searching for in search engines. By targeting the right keywords, you can optimize your website to appear in the search results when users search for those keywords.For example, if you have a website selling fitnessequipment, you might want to target keywords like "best fitness equipment," "home workout gear," or "exercise machines."2. On-Page Optimization: This step involves optimizing the content and structure of your webpages. It includes optimizing the title tags, meta descriptions, headers, and URL structure. On-page optimization also involves incorporating the targeted keywords naturally into the content, optimizing images, and improving the overall user experience.For example, you can include the targeted keyword in the title tag, meta description, and headers of your webpage. You can also optimize the images by adding alt tags with relevant keywords.3. Off-Page Optimization: Off-page optimization refers to activities done outside of your website to improve its visibility and credibility. This includes building high-quality backlinks from other reputable websites, social media marketing, guest blogging, and influencer outreach.For example, you can reach out to fitness bloggers or influencers in the industry and ask them to link back to your website or share your content on their social media platforms.4. Technical SEO: Technical SEO involves optimizing the technical aspects of your website to improve its performance and crawlability by search engines. This includes optimizing the website's loading speed, mobile-friendliness, site structure, and ensuring proper indexing by search engines.For example, you can compress images to reduce their file size and improve loading speed. You can also implement responsive design to make your website mobile-friendly.5. Content Creation and Optimization: Creating high-quality and relevant content is crucial for SEO. This includes creating informative blog posts, articles, videos, infographics, and other types of content that provide value to your target audience. Optimizing the content involvesincorporating the targeted keywords naturally, using proper headings and formatting, and making the content easy toread and understand.For example, if you have a fitness website, you can create blog posts about workout routines, nutrition tips,or product reviews. Personalized PageRankIntroductionPageRank is an algorithm used by search engines to rank web pages based on their importance and relevance. It is a key component of the Google search engine and is widely used in the field of web search and web mining. The traditional PageRank algorithm ranks web pages solely based on their link structure, disregarding user preferences and personalized information.However, in recent years, there has been a growing need for personalized search results. Users often have different preferences and interests, and they expect search engines to provide them with tailored and relevant content. To address this need, personalized PageRank algorithms have been developed to incorporate user-specific information into the ranking process.Overview of Personalized PageRankPersonalized PageRank is an extension of the traditional PageRank algorithm that takes into account user preferences and interests. It assigns a personalized importance score to each web page based on its relevance to the user.The algorithm starts by assigning an initial importance score to each web page in the network. This can be done using various methods, such as uniformly distributing the scores or assigning higher scores to specific pages based on user preferences.Next, the algorithm iteratively updates the importance scores of the web pages based on their link structure and the user’s preferences. It takes into account both the importance of the pages that link to a given page and the importance of the user’s preferred pages. The process continues until the importance scores converge, indicating a stable ranking.Calculating Personalized PageRankThe calculation of personalized PageRank involves several steps:1.Define the user preferences: Users can provide their preferencesdirectly or implicitly through their search history, clickpatterns, or feedback. These preferences can be represented as apreference vector, where each element represents the user’sinterest in a specific topic or category.2.Construct the transition probability matrix: The transitionprobability matrix represents the likelihood of transitioning from one page to another in the network. It is calculated based on the link structure of the web pages. Each element of the matrixrepresents the probability of transitioning from one page toanother through a hyperlink. The matrix is typically sparse andcan be efficiently represented using sparse matrix techniques.3.Initialize the importance scores: The importance scores of the webpages are initialized based on the user preferences. Pages thatare more relevant to the user are assigned higher initial scores. 4.Update the importance scores iteratively: The importance scoresare updated iteratively using the transition probability matrix.At each iteration, the importance score of a page is calculated asa weighted sum of the importance scores of the pages that link toit, considering both the importance of the linking pages and theuser preferences.5.Convergence criteria: The iteration process continues until theimportance scores converge. A common convergence criterion is tostop the iterations when the L1 distance between the importancescores of consecutive iterations falls below a predeterminedthreshold.Advantages of Personalized PageRankPersonalized PageRank has several advantages over traditional PageRank: 1.Relevance: Personalized PageRank considers user preferences andinterests, resulting in search results that are more relevant and tailored to the user’s needs. Users are more likely to find theinformation they are looking for quickly and easily.2.Diversity: Personalized PageRank can also take into account theneed for diversity in search results. It can balance betweenproviding results that are highly relevant to the user’spreferences and presenting a diverse set of options to explore. er feedback incorporation: Personalized PageRank can incorporateuser feedback, such as clicks, likes, and dislikes, tocontinuously improve the search results. By learning from theuser’s interactions, the algorithm can adapt and provide betterrecommendations over time.4.Dynamic ranking: Personalized PageRank can be used to createdynamic rankings that adapt to changing user preferences andinterests. As the user’s preferences evolve, the algorithm canupdate the importance scores accordingly, ensuring that the search results remain up to date.Applications of Personalized PageRankPersonalized PageRank has various applications beyond web search:1.Recommender systems: Personalized PageRank can be used inrecommender systems to provide personalized recommendations tousers, based on their preferences and interests. It can help users discover new content that is relevant to their interests andincrease user engagement.2.Social networks: Personalized PageRank can be applied to socialnetwork analysis to identify influential users or groups of users.By considering the interactions between users and theirpreferences, the algorithm can identify the most important nodesin the network based on personalized influence.3.E-commerce: Personalized PageRank can be used in e-commerceplatforms to recommend relevant products to users. By taking into account the user’s preferences, purchase history, and browsingbehavior, the algorithm can generate personalized productrecommendations that increase conversion rates.rmation retrieval: Personalized PageRank can be used toimprove the effectiveness of information retrieval systems. Byincorporating user preferences, the algorithm can rank searchresults based on their relevance to the user, leading to betterretrieval performance.ConclusionPersonalized PageRank is a valuable algorithm for providing personalized and relevant search results. By incorporating user preferences and interests, it can generate tailored rankings that meet the individual needs of users. With its applications in various domains, personalized PageRank has the potential to enhance the user experience and improve the effectiveness of recommendation systems, social network analysis, and information retrieval.。

信息检索文章英译汉Information retrieval(IR)is the process of obtaining information from a collection of information sources. It involves searching and retrieving relevant information to satisfy a user's information needs.The field of information retrieval has seen significant advancements in recent decades with the development of computer technology. In the past, information retrieval was a manual process where librarians would search through catalogues and indexes to find relevant information for patrons. However, with the advent of the Internet and search engines, information retrieval has become automated and more efficient.Search engines, such as Google, use complex algorithms to index and rank web pages based on their relevance to a user's query. These algorithms take into account various factors such as keyword frequency, page popularity, and user behavior to deliver the most relevant results. Users can then navigate through the search results to find the information they are looking for. Information retrieval is not limited to web search engines. It also encompasses other domains such as database searching, digital libraries, and text mining. In these domains, information retrieval techniques are used to retrieve relevant information from structured and unstructured data sources.There are several important components in an information retrieval system. The first component is the collection of documents or information sources. These sources can be web pages, databases,or any other type of information repository. The second componentis the indexing process, where documents are analyzed and indexed based on their content. This allows for faster and more efficient retrieval of information. The third component is the search interface, which allows users to input their queries and retrieve relevant information. The final component is the ranking algorithm, which determines the order in which the retrieved documents are presented to the user.In conclusion, information retrieval is a critical process in today's digital age. It allows users to quickly and efficiently find the information they need from vast amounts of data. Whether it is searching the web, databases, or other information sources, information retrieval techniques play a crucial role in accessing and organizing information.。

5.Location,Location,Location
Location……And Frequency
One of the main rules in a ranking algorithm involves the location and frequency of keywords on a web page.Call it the location/frequency method,for short.Remember the librarian mentioned above?They need to find books to match your request of“travel,”so it makes sense that they first look at books with travel in the title.Search engines operate the same way.Pages with the search terms appearing in the HTML title tag are often assumed to be more relevant than others to the topic.Search engines will also check to see if the search keywords appear near the top of a web page,such as in the headline or in the first few paragraphs of text.They assume that any page relevant to the topic will mention those words right from the beginning.Frequency is the other major factor in how search engines determine relevancy.A search engine will analyze how often keywords appear in relation to other words in a web page.Those with a higher frequency are often deemed more relevant than other web pages.
6.Cached Pages
Google takes a snapshot of each page it examines and caches(stores)that version as a back-up. The cached version is what Google uses to judge if a page is a good match for your query. Practically every search result includes a Cached link.Clicking on that link takes you to the Google cached version of that web page,instead of the current version of the page.This is useful if the original page is unavailable because of:
•Internet congestion
•A down,overloaded,or just slow website
•The owner’s recently removing the page from the Web
Sometimes you can access the cached version from a site that otherwise require registration or a subscription.
Note:Since Google’s servers are typically faster than many web servers,you can often access a page’s cached version faster than the page itself.
If Google returns a link to a page that appears to have little to do with your query,or if you can’t find the information you’re seeking on the current version of the page,take a look at the cached version.
